
Running a farm requires dedication, resilience, and the right kind of help—both human and canine. A good farm dog is more than just a pet; it’s a worker, a herder, a guardian, and a loyal companion all rolled into one. Whether you need a dog to herd livestock, patrol the perimeter, or keep pests at bay, choosing the right breed can make all the difference. Here’s a guide to the best dogs for farms, handpicked for their intelligence, work ethic, and unwavering loyalty.
1. Border Collie
The Herding Genius
Border Collies are widely regarded as the smartest dog breed in the world, and for good reason. Originally bred for herding sheep in the rugged hills of Scotland and England, they are agile, highly trainable, and tireless workers.
Why it works on farms:
- Incredibly quick learners
- Masters at herding sheep, goats, and cattle
- Energetic and alert for long days in the field
Best for: Livestock-heavy farms needing daily herding support.
2. Australian Cattle Dog
The Tireless Cattle Chaser
Also known as the Blue Heeler or Red Heeler, this tough and muscular breed was developed in Australia to handle cattle across harsh terrains. They are independent thinkers and fierce protectors.
Why it works on farms:
- High stamina for long work days
- Protective and loyal
- Great with cattle and even pigs
Best for: Ranches and larger farms where cattle need consistent guidance.
3. Great Pyrenees
The Guardian Angel of the Flock
Originally bred to protect livestock from wolves in the Pyrenees Mountains, this gentle giant is a natural at guarding sheep and goats. Calm and independent, they work best when left to patrol freely.
Why it works on farms:
- Strong guardian instincts
- Can live outdoors year-round
- Low prey drive toward livestock
Best for: Sheep or goat farms in rural areas with predator threats.
4. Anatolian Shepherd
The Fearless Livestock Protector
This ancient Turkish breed is bred specifically for livestock guarding. Anatolians are large, confident, and capable of confronting predators like coyotes and mountain lions.
Why it works on farms:
- Natural guardian instinct without much training
- Minimal barking unless there’s a real threat
- Known for being reliable and independent
Best for: Large-acreage farms that need 24/7 protection of flocks.
5. Australian Shepherd
The Agile All-Rounder
Despite the name, Australian Shepherds were actually developed in the United States. Highly intelligent and full of energy, they excel in both herding and companion roles.
Why it works on farms:
- Easy to train and eager to work
- Great with children and families
- Multi-taskers: herd, guard, and even retrieve
Best for: Medium-sized farms that need a versatile helper.
6. Belgian Malinois
The Military Dog That Means Business
While often associated with police and military service, the Belgian Malinois is also a fantastic farm protector. Agile, strong, and obedient, they can help with herding and guarding duties alike.
Why it works on farms:
- Fiercely loyal and protective
- Great at learning complex commands
- Excellent perimeter guardians
Best for: Farms needing security and herding from the same dog.
7. Old English Sheepdog
The Shaggy Worker with a Gentle Soul
Don’t let the fluffy coat fool you. This breed was once a cattle driver in the British countryside. They’re smart, affectionate, and able to keep up with rigorous tasks.
Why it works on farms:
- Good at herding and watching over animals
- Calm around children and other pets
- Adapts well to both work and relaxation
Best for: Smaller family farms where personality matters as much as productivity.
8. Labrador Retriever
The Versatile Farm Companion
Labs may not be traditional herders or guardians, but their intelligence, loyalty, and willingness to learn make them a wonderful addition to any farm.
Why it works on farms:
- Easy to train and eager to please
- Great for retrieving tasks, hunting, or even pest control
- Friendly with visitors and children
Best for: Multi-purpose farms looking for a helpful family dog that can also contribute.
9. German Shepherd
The Disciplined Worker
German Shepherds are smart, strong, and reliable. Known for their service roles, they can also excel on farms when trained for herding or security.
Why it works on farms:
- Obedient and versatile
- Excellent guard instincts
- Loyal to a fault
Best for: Farms needing both herding and protection, especially with mixed livestock.
10. Jack Russell Terrier
The Tiny Pest Patrol
While not a herding or guarding breed, the energetic and feisty Jack Russell is a specialist in one department—pest control. Rats, mice, and other small farm intruders are no match for this dog.
Why it works on farms:
- Incredible drive and prey instinct
- Low maintenance and adaptable
- Keeps barns, silos, and sheds rodent-free
Best for: Crop farms, granaries, and farms with food storage that attract pests.
How to Choose the Right Farm Dog

Choosing the right dog depends on your farm’s specific needs:
- Herding needs? Go with Border Collies, Australian Shepherds, or Cattle Dogs.
- Guarding livestock? Look into Anatolian Shepherds or Great Pyrenees.
- Pest control? Terriers like the Jack Russell are unbeatable.
- All-around helpers and companions? Labrador Retrievers or German Shepherds fit the bill.
Also consider:
- Climate tolerance
- Training ability
- Compatibility with children and other animals
- Size and maintenance needs
Conclusion
A farm dog is more than just an animal—they’re a member of the working family. Whether they’re rounding up sheep, standing guard at night, or chasing off rodents, these dogs offer dedication and love with every task they take on. The right dog can increase your farm’s efficiency, safety, and spirit. Choose wisely, train well, and build a partnership that thrives in mud, sun, snow, and storm.